EraElite by Aerolase® Medium Depth Ablation
Overview
The Aerolase® Era for Medium Depth Ablation is excellent for eliminating sun damage, reducing brown spots or patches, and erasing fine lines. This treatment gently vaporizes the skin’s outermost layer to reveal the youthful glow beneath. It is optimal for those with more advanced signs of aging who are willing to accommodate a little downtime.

EraElite by Aerolase® Deep Depth Ablation
Overview
For individuals with progressive signs of aging who don’t mind a little downtime, the Aerolase® Era for Deep Depth Ablation is an excellent choice. This treatment uses a deep-penetrating laser to completely renew the skin’s epidermal tissue, resulting in dramatic improvements in deep wrinkles, extensive sun damage, brown spots, and acne scars.

EraElite by Aerolase® Scars & Cutaneous Lesions
Overview
Scar tissue, cutaneous lesions, and benign growths can be effectively treated with the Aerolase® Era. This treatment gently removes the scar or lesion while preserving the surrounding skin. The affected area is ablated by removing a layer with each pulse until the lesion is completely gone, typically within one to two sessions. This process results in a uniform skin tone and texture. Thanks to the Era’s unique capability to treat patients with only a beam of laser light touching the skin, all body areas can be treated comfortably
